The world¶
The world of Europa is a continent-rich planet with five major continents and a number of smaller islands.
-
Central stage of the Continental Wars. Home to Arcadia, Choktovakia, Gorlund, Volnia, Rakutania, CSAT, Livonia, Chartania, and others.
-
Colder northern continent, dominated by the rivalry of the Leipzisch Kaiserreich, the Republic of Velicuse, and the Union of Thumbrian Soviet Republics.
-
Warm, arid-to-tropical southern continent. Home to the Sur'Bari Sultanate, Empire of Mahasrana, and other Caldorian states.
-
Continental mainland and long island arcs. Home to the Xianren Federation, the Hinomuran Federation, and the Pelawan / Telinor archipelagos.
-
Southern continent with surrounding island confederations. Home to the Austran Federation, Wirrindi Territory, Mulwarra, and Yarrabilla.
-
Polar continent at the far south of Europa, surrounded by the Ultimal Ocean. Subject to international treaty regimes.
